Grinded Coconut Sambar
ORIGIN
'Grinded Coconut Sambar or kulambu' is frequently or almost daily made recipe in the state of kerala in Tamil Nadu.It is taken with plain boiled rice and ghee.It is not advisable everyday for heart patients as it consists of cholestrol,however once in a while can be taken .

INGREDIENTS

Black Gram - 2 tsps. (ulundhu)

Grated Coconut - 1 cup

Red chilli - 4 pieces

Fenu Greek - 1/4 tsps.

Oil - 2 tsps.

mustard - 1/2 tsp.

Curry leaves - to taste

Tamarind - a lemon sized ball

Salt - to taste

PROCEDURE

Step 1: Add 1 tsp. full of oil into the frying pan and fry the red chilli pieces,Black gram dhal,grated coconut and fenu greek in the pan for 2 minutes.Then,grind the above mixture (wet) in a mixer-grinder to make a thick paste.

Step 2:Soak the lemon-sized ball of tamarind in water (1 cup) and dissolve it for 10 minutes.Keep it aside.

Step 3:Now,add salt to the tamarind water and boil it for 10 minutes.

Step 4:After 10 minutes,add the above grinded paste into the boiled tamarind water for 10 minutes again.Now , when the mixture thickens ,add 1 1/2 cups of water into it and boil for 5 to 7 minutes.Keep it aside.

Step 5:Now add 1 tsp. full of oil in another frying pan and add mustard seeds and curry leaves and fry them until mustard seeds sputters.Now,add this into the above boiled mixture.

Step 6:Serve hot with plain boiled rice and ghee.

NOTE:
* Take all the ingredients in the above mentioned quantity only.
*Use fresh coconut and donot use the old ones as that does not taste good.
*Do not forget to soak the tamarind in water .
